The Influence of Work Environment and Workload on Nurses’ Performance in Inpatient Care Units Bianti Putri Sekarani; Farida Yuliaty; Etty Sofia Mariati Asnar; Ayu Laili Rahmiyati; Vip Paramarta

Abstract

Improving the quality of hospital services is strongly associated with the performance of nurses, who play a vital role in delivering patient care and ensuring organizational effectiveness. Nurses’ performance is influenced by various factors, particularly the work environment and workload. A supportive work environment can enhance motivation, job satisfaction, and productivity, while a balanced workload enables nurses to perform their duties efficiently and maintain high standards of care. This study aimed to analyze the effects of the work environment and workload on the performance of nurses in the inpatient unit of Royal Prima Jambi Hospital, both individually and simultaneously. A quantitative research design was employed, involving 48 nurses selected as study participants. Data were collected through structured questionnaires and analyzed using multiple linear regression techniques. The findings revealed that both the work environment (X1) and workload (X2) had a positive and statistically significant effect on nurses’ performance (Y). These results indicate that improvements in workplace conditions and effective workload management contribute substantially to enhanced nursing performance. Furthermore, the coefficient of determination (R²) was 0.721, demonstrating that 72.1% of the variation in nurses’ performance could be explained by the combined influence of the work environment and workload, while the remaining 27.9% was attributable to other factors not examined in this study. The study highlights the importance of creating a conducive work environment and implementing appropriate workload allocation strategies to optimize nurses’ performance and improve the overall quality of healthcare services. These findings provide valuable insights for hospital management in developing policies aimed at strengthening workforce performance and service quality.

THE POTENTIAL AND SUCCESS OF EQUITY CROWDFUNDING IN INDONESIA: EXPLORING THE SIGNALING HYPOTHESIS AND FINANCIAL LITERACY CHALLENGES Kosasih; Vip Paramarta; Zaenal Aripin

Abstract

Stock crowdfunding has become an increasingly popular phenomenon in Indonesia, offering new opportunities for small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) to access capital by involving individual investors. However, the success of stock crowdfunding is uncertain and is related to several factors, including the use of signaling hypotheses by companies and the level of financial literacy among investors. This research aims to explore the potential and success of stock crowdfunding in Indonesia by examining signaling hypotheses and the financial literacy challenges faced. The research method used is qualitative, analyzing data from relevant journals, articles, and books. The results show that signaling hypotheses play a significant role in influencing investor interest and the success of stock crowdfunding campaigns. Companies that use positive signals, such as strong financial performance or the participation of prominent investors, tend to be more successful in attracting potential investors. However, financial literacy challenges, such as a lack of understanding of investment concepts and financial risks, are significant barriers to increasing participation and success in stock crowdfunding in Indonesia.
BETWEEN INNOVATION AND CHALLENGES: UTILIZATION OF BLOCKCHAIN AND CLOUD PLATFORMS IN THE TRANSFORMATION OF BANKING SERVICES IN THE DIGITAL ERA Zaenal Aripin; Vip Paramarta; Kosasih

Abstract

Banking in the digital era is increasingly pressured to adopt new technologies to update and improve their services. Two prominent technologies in the transformation of banking services are blockchain and cloud computing. Blockchain technology offers security and transparency, while cloud computing provides flexibility and efficiency in IT infrastructure. This research aims to explore the innovations and challenges associated with the utilization of blockchain and cloud technologies in the transformation of banking services in the digital era. We seek to understand how banks implement these technologies and identify factors influencing the success or failure of implementation. The research method used is descriptive qualitative. Data were collected through literature studies from journals, articles, and books relevant to this research topic. Analysis was conducted to identify trends, challenges, and benefits of using blockchain and cloud technologies in banking services. The results show that the utilization of blockchain and cloud technologies has brought significant changes in banking services, including improved security, operational efficiency, and financial inclusion. However, banks also face several challenges, including technical complexity, initial investment costs, and regulatory compliance.
